Skater? Nope, Extreme😎 Customer was looking for better handling on his '21 Extreme.
After the first test drive, we found the 10-inch offset bracket was creating handling and drivability issues. The fix? Moving the center of gravity forward with a 4-inch Bob’s Machine Shop jack plate to get the boat balanced and performing the way it should.

Another example of why proper setup matters when it comes to performance.

Another beautiful day in San Diego with this Eliminator Eagle on deck for restoration☀️🚤
This project included a complete trailer brake system replacement with new actuator, lines, rotors, calipers, pads, bearings, etc, giving all four wheels braking power for safer towing.
We also tracked down and sealed multiple leaks by resealing the swim steps, trim tabs, drain plug, and transom shield. To finish it off, we repaired a damaged hatch with fresh fiberglass and gel coat, then replaced the hatch pad and worn interior cushions.

Update on the Avalon tritoon with twin Mercury 400Rs! After the #6 piston failure, the best solution was a brand-new Mercury long block. We transferred all of the original components over, cleaned the oil pan and injectors, installed a new oil pump and oil thermostat, and completed a full service on both motors. She's back together, fired up, and running strong. One final lake test and she'll be headed back to her owner! 🔧🚤 ry400R
